Transaction 023eadb1515f375f5fe8eaec779beb56649e93a96469ffab93b5f07d3572dc42

2 Input
1 Outputs
  • 023eadb1515f375f5fe8eaec779beb56649e93a96469ffab93b5f07d3572dc42:0
  • value  570212
    address  3FwBM7nSWfPZCnYLDBszzP99RgcmUF2SHb